On Thu, 14 Nov 2024 15:33:32 GMT, Tobias Holenstein <tholenstein at openjdk.org> wrote:
>> IGV XML already support to define which graphs are visible when opened. Extend the IdealGraphPrinter::print... in C2 to define which nodes should be visible in IGV when sent over the network
>>
>> ### Add a new option "!" to dump_bfs
>> The option ! send the printed nodes of dump_bfs to IGV and shows them
>>
>> p find_node(0)->dump_bfs(1,0,"dcmxo+!")
>>
>> dist dump
>> ---------------------------------------------
>> 1 51 Return === 46 6 47 8 9 returns 39 [[ 0 ]]
>> 0 0 Root === 0 51 [[ 0 1 3 26 ]]
>> Method printed over network stream to IGV
